Pros & Cons for Telegram
Pros
- ✓ Proven no-logs policy — verified in court
- ✓ Massive server network — 35,000+ servers
- ✓ Open-source apps for transparency
- ✓ Port 443 support bypasses network blocks
Cons
- ✗ Speeds can vary across distant servers
- ✗ Interface is less polished than competitors

Does Private Internet Access work with Telegram?
Yes, Private Internet Access works well with Telegram. In our testing, it scored 8.6/10 for Telegram-specific performance, with a 88% censorship bypass success rate.
Can Private Internet Access unblock Telegram in China?
Yes, Private Internet Access has obfuscation technology that helps bypass China's Great Firewall to access Telegram.
Is Private Internet Access good for Telegram calls?
Private Internet Access scored 84% in our Telegram call quality tests. Call quality is good for most use cases, though premium alternatives may offer better performance.
